48 million Americans had a substance use disorder last year. Most never received care. The waitlists are months long and people are dying before they get a bed.
Jay Tobey, founder of North Star Recovery & Wellness, is raising approximately $115 million to acquire behavioral health facilities and add 500 beds to meet this overwhelming demand. His approach: acquire facilities offering detox, residential, and outpatient services, retrofit existing buildings instead of building new, and prove that a capitalistic model is the only sustainable way to solve the behavioral health crisis at scale.
In this episode, Jay and Sam Sells dive deep into the operational realities of addiction treatment, the failures of government-run facilities, the shifting stigma around mental health, and untapped funding opportunities in HUD and suicide prevention that could be redirected to support sober living.
